Transaction 28820f85632bf29306a50794a56f5c25bdbd63231a31a6d97557375f73611cd8
1 Input
1 Output
-
28820f85632bf29306a50794a56f5c25bdbd63231a31a6d97557375f73611cd8:0
- value
- 51216
- script pubkey
- OP_0 OP_PUSHBYTES_20 39d8addc7162a6ad7bfeba2bb0c1ce3b650a1c81
- address
- bc1q88v2mhr3v2n267l7hg4mpsww8djs58ypezlr04